At Rocket Factory Augsburg (RFA), we have one clear goal: to create low-cost, flexible, and reliable access to space. We specialize in building small launch vehicles designed to deploy satellites into Low Earth Orbit (LEO) and beyond. Our international and agile team is searching for a Technician and Plant Operator (f/m/d) in the UK. This is a rare opportunity to be involved in building and operation UK’s first vertical launch site. You will help lead the fabrication, installation, commissioning and maintenance of systems at our Launch site on the Shetland Islands, with the opportunity to travel to our other sites across Europe should the need arise. You will have the choice of either being based at the launch site in Unst, or working on a rotation pattern. If you enjoy working in a dynamic and international team of dedicated people, then apply.
Your Tasks
- Carry out fabrication work in support of site construction, operation and maintenance
- Carry out the mechanical installation and commissioning of new systems at the launch site
- Assemble fluid lines to a high cleanliness standard
- Perform maintenance, inspections, repairs and upgrade work on launch site systems
- Ensure all equipment is well maintained and serviced at appropriate intervals, and that the state of equipment is well documented
- Assist in AIT operations on engines and launch vehicle stages
Your Qualifications
- Experience in metal work and fabrication – cutting, grinding, bending, deburing
- Ability to read and interpret technical drawings, schematics, and manuals
- Experience with Swagelok assembly is desirable
- Experience with pneumatic systems is desirable
- Experience with cryogenic systems is desirable
- Experience in hydraulic systems is desirable
- Team player, and works calmly under pressure
- Willing to work outdoors and in a remote location
